图灵测试chatgpt怎么弄
-
要了解如何进行图灵测试(Turing Test)与ChatGPT,首先需要了解两个概念。
图灵测试是由英国数学家艾伦·图灵(Alan Turing)在1950年提出的一种测试人工智能是否能够表现出与人类无法区分的智能水平的测试方法。图灵测试的基本思想是通过一个对话系统,让一个人与一个机器(或计算机程序)进行对话,如果这个人无法通过对话判断出对方是否是机器,则可以认为该机器具有人类水平的智能。
ChatGPT是由OpenAI发布的一种基于深度学习的对话生成模型。它经过大规模训练,具备了生成流畅、回答问题、理解上下文等对话能力。和其他模型相比,ChatGPT更具互动性,可以像和一个智能机器人交谈一样进行对话。
那么,要进行图灵测试与ChatGPT,可以按照以下步骤进行:
1. 了解图灵测试要求:图灵测试中,机器需要模拟一个人类的对话,而不是简单地回答问题。对机器的测试应该是连续的、实时的,以确保机器具备持久且自然的对话能力。
2. 部署ChatGPT模型:参考OpenAI的文档,将ChatGPT部署到自己的环境中。OpenAI提供了API接口,也可以使用预训练模型进行测试。
3. 定义测试指标:根据图灵测试的要求,定义对话的质量指标。可以考虑对话流畅度、逻辑性、上下文理解等方面进行评估。
4. 构建对话场景:选择一个合适的对话场景,可以是日常对话、技术支持、问答等。确保测试能够覆盖多类问题和不同的对话情境。
5. 进行测试:与ChatGPT进行对话。尝试提出各种类型的问题,并评估ChatGPT的回答是否合理,是否能够理解上下文并做出连贯的回应。
6. 评估测试结果:根据定义的测试指标评估ChatGPT的质量。可以采用人工评估、自动评估等方式进行。
7. 提升ChatGPT的性能:根据测试结果,发现ChatGPT在哪些方面表现较差,进行相应的改进和优化。可以通过增加训练数据、微调模型参数等方式提升性能。
需要注意的是,图灵测试是一种标准,而ChatGPT只是一种机器人模型。进行图灵测试时,不仅要关注ChatGPT的性能,也要考虑对话系统的整体效果和交互体验。这需要在测试中进行综合评估。
2年前 -
要使用图灵测试(Turing Test)来评估ChatGPT的性能,您需要按照以下步骤进行操作:
1. 确定测试参数:确定您想要测试的ChatGPT的版本和参数。图灵测试的目标是判断ChatGPT是否能够在与人类对话时表现得像一个真实的人类一样。因此,您需要确定测试的文本输入和输出的格式、对话的时间长度以及其他相关的设置。
2. 准备测试集合:生成一个用于测试ChatGPT的对话数据集合。这可以是人工标注的数据集合,其中包含针对ChatGPT的输入和预期输出的对话样本。
3. 设计实验:根据您选择的测试参数,设计一个实验来测试ChatGPT的表现。这个实验可能会涉及到多轮对话、特定主题的讨论、非常规或具有挑战性的问题等。
4. 运行测试并记录结果:使用设计好的实验参数,将测试数据喂给ChatGPT,并记录其生成的响应。根据图灵测试的标准,如果ChatGPT的响应使得人类无法区分是机器人还是真实人类所作出的回答,则可以认为ChatGPT通过了测试。
5. 分析和评估:对测试结果进行分析和评估。这可能包括评估ChatGPT的响应的流畅性、合理性和准确性。还可以使用客观的指标(如回答正确率、生成自然语言的质量等)来衡量ChatGPT的性能。
需要注意的是,尽管图灵测试是评估ChatGPT的一种方法,但它并不是唯一的方法。该测试还存在一些争议,因为它只检验了ChatGPT是否能够欺骗人类,而不一定反映了其真正的智能水平。因此,在评估ChatGPT时,还需要结合其他评价指标和实验方法。
2年前 -
图灵测试(Turing test)是由英国数学家和计算机科学家艾伦·图灵在1950年提出的一种评估机器智能的标准。图灵测试的目标是测试一个机器是否具有与人类相似的智能。ChatGPT是一个基于开放AI的GPT模型,它可以用于聊天和对话。
要进行图灵测试ChatGPT,您可以按照以下步骤进行:
1. 注册和登录:首先,您需要注册和登录到OpenAI平台。注册成功后,您将获得一个API密钥,用于访问ChatGPT。
2. 理解API文档:在开始使用ChatGPT之前,您应该仔细阅读OpenAI的API文档,了解API的功能和限制。这将帮助您使用API的正确方式。
3. 客户端设置:您需要选择一个合适的平台或技术栈来设置ChatGPT的客户端。您可以使用Python编程语言,并使用OpenAI的GPT-Python库。
4. 了解输入和输出参数:在与ChatGPT交互之前,您应该了解输入和输出参数。输入是一个包含聊天历史和要求机器人回答的消息列表。输出是ChatGPT生成的响应。
5. 构建交互循环:在与ChatGPT进行聊天之前,您需要构建一个交互循环。循环将不断向ChatGPT发送输入并接收输出。您可以设置循环的条件,例如最大回合数或停止命令。
6. 调试和优化:在使用ChatGPT进行图灵测试之前,您应该进行调试和优化。您可以对输入消息进行预处理或过滤,以确保触发机器人合适的回答。
7. 运行图灵测试:一旦您的交互循环设置好并且您对 ChatGPT 的配置满意,您可以开始进行图灵测试了。在图灵测试期间,您可以与ChatGPT进行对话,并观察其是否表现得足够像一个真实的人类。
需要注意的是,ChatGPT是一个预训练的语言模型,它在训练过程中接触到的数据源包含了互联网上的大量信息。因此在测试过程中,有时ChatGPT可能会生成一些不合适或不准确的回答。您可以通过使用负反馈来告诉ChatGPT哪些回答不是您想要的,以帮助改进它的表现。
以上是使用图灵测试ChatGPT的一般步骤。希望对您有帮助!
2年前